This issue has almost come full circle for me.  The best thing to come out
of it for me was fixing lcStackBrowser to not save itself so it's not
affected by the 7.0 format, but I'm glad it developed into a discussion,
and possible solution, for the LC plugin mechanisms.

Another thing I learned from it is that the 7.0 User Extensions setting is
separate from prior versions.  I haven't been able to find any mention of
that in the release notes and it really seems like a key piece of
information for folks who want to do their community service in testing 7.0.

Is that unique to 7.0 or do all versions have their own separate User
Extensions setting?

Ironically, I'm blocked from testing lcStackBrowser with 7.0 because of two
serious bugs, one during initial compile on a show with visual effect
command, and another during execution on an arraydecode statement.  QCC
looking into them.
